Broome County Emergency Services officials say it appears a ceiling fan is responsible for a fire at a home in Conklin shortly before midnight November 6, drawing crews from several fire departments.

The blaze on Woodside Avenue was extinguished by the homeowner who pulled the fan down and put out the flames.  There were no injuries and damage was confined to one room.

Officials say the family was able to find shelter at a neighbor’s house and the home can be repaired.
